Code P1FF2 Description
The diagnostic trouble code P1FF2 refers to an issue with the Hybrid/EV Battery Interface Control Module 10 Voltage Sensor Performance. This code indicates that there is a problem with the voltage sensor within the control module that monitors the voltage levels of the hybrid or electric vehicle's battery. The voltage sensor is crucial for ensuring the proper functioning of the battery system, as it helps regulate the charging and discharging processes. If left unresolved, this issue can lead to a variety of performance problems and potentially cause damage to the battery system.
Common Causes of P1FF2
- Faulty Voltage Sensor: The most common cause of this code is a malfunctioning voltage sensor within the Hybrid/EV Battery Interface Control Module.
- Wiring Issues: Poor electrical connections or damaged wiring can also trigger this code by disrupting the voltage sensor's readings.
- Battery System Malfunction: Problems within the hybrid or electric vehicle's battery system, such as a failing battery or defective components, can lead to this code.
- Software Glitch: A software glitch or programming error within the control module can cause erroneous readings from the voltage sensor.
- Environmental Factors: Extreme temperatures or exposure to moisture can also affect the performance of the voltage sensor and trigger this code.
Symptoms of P1FF2
- Check Engine Light: The most common symptom associated with this code is the illumination of the check engine light on the vehicle's dashboard.
- Poor Fuel Efficiency: A malfunctioning voltage sensor can impact the vehicle's fuel efficiency, causing it to consume more fuel than usual.
- Battery Charging Issues: The vehicle may experience difficulties in charging the battery, leading to inconsistent or slow charging times.
- Power Loss: The vehicle may suffer from power loss, especially during acceleration or when driving uphill.
- Inconsistent Battery Performance: The battery may not hold a charge properly or may experience rapid discharging, affecting the vehicle's overall performance.
How to Fix P1FF2
- Diagnostic Scan: Begin by performing a diagnostic scan using a specialized OBD-II scanner to retrieve the specific trouble code and identify the issue.
- Inspect Wiring and Connections: Check the wiring harness and electrical connections related to the voltage sensor for any signs of damage or corrosion. Repair or replace as needed.
- Test Voltage Sensor: Test the voltage sensor's functionality to determine if it is providing accurate readings. Replace the sensor if it fails the test.
- Update Software: If a software glitch is suspected, update the control module's software to the latest version to address any programming errors.
- Battery System Check: Conduct a comprehensive check of the hybrid or electric vehicle's battery system to ensure that all components are functioning correctly and replace any faulty parts.
Cost to Fix P1FF2
The typical repair costs for addressing the P1FF2 code related to the Hybrid/EV Battery Interface Control Module 10 Voltage Sensor Performance can vary depending on the extent of the issue and the specific repairs needed. In general, parts and labor for this repair could range from $200 to $500. However, it is essential to keep in mind that diagnostic time and labor rates at auto repair shops can vary significantly based on factors such as location, vehicle make and model, and engine type. Therefore, it is advisable to check with local auto repair shops for a more accurate estimate.

Frequently Asked Questions about P1FF2 Code
What does the OBDII code P1FF2 mean?
P1FF2 indicates a performance issue with the voltage sensor in the Hybrid/EV Battery Interface Control Module 10, which monitors and manages battery voltage levels.
What are the common symptoms of code P1FF2?
Symptoms may include an illuminated check engine light, reduced hybrid/EV performance, decreased fuel efficiency, or limited drivability in EV mode.
What causes the P1FF2 code to appear?
Possible causes include a faulty voltage sensor, damaged wiring or connectors, module software glitches, or a failing Hybrid/EV Battery Interface Control Module.
Can I drive my vehicle with the P1FF2 code?
It’s not recommended to drive for extended periods with this code, as it may lead to further damage or reduced vehicle performance. Seek professional diagnosis and repair promptly.
How is the P1FF2 code diagnosed?
A technician will use a diagnostic scanner to confirm the code, inspect the wiring and connectors, test the voltage sensor, and evaluate the Hybrid/EV Battery Interface Control Module.
What repairs are needed to fix the P1FF2 code?
Repairs may include replacing the faulty voltage sensor, repairing damaged wiring or connectors, updating module software, or replacing the Hybrid/EV Battery Interface Control Module.
How much does it cost to fix the P1FF2 code?
Repair costs vary but may range from $100 for minor wiring repairs to over $1,000 if the Hybrid/EV Battery Interface Control Module needs replacement.
Can a software update fix the P1FF2 code?
In some cases, a software update for the Hybrid/EV Battery Interface Control Module can resolve the issue if it’s caused by a programming glitch.
What tools are needed to diagnose the P1FF2 code?
A professional-grade OBDII scanner, a multimeter, and relevant service manuals are typically required to accurately diagnose the issue.
Is P1FF2 a common code in hybrid or electric vehicles?
P1FF2 is not extremely common but can occur in certain hybrid or electric vehicles if their battery voltage monitoring system malfunctions.
